I cannot say enough good things about your beautiful house. My group and I were so sad to leave that we are already planning on returning! Finding the house was the hardest part as it's in this little community with some unmarked streets, and its at the end of one of the roads, but once we found it, it was a breeze to come and go. We had 8 people in our group ranging in age from 21-27 and at first we were a little nervous about there not being a television in the house, but we did not miss it at all! There is so much to do in the house and in the area that a tv is totally unnecessary. The pool is an added bonus of course and the scenery around the house is breathtaking. Yes, there are lizards, coqui's, snails and other bugs that come and go, but we consider that part of the beauty of staying in a house in the rainforest. Falling asleep to the sound of coqui's was so relaxing and truly made us feel like we were getting the whole "Puerto Rican" experience! The house had everything we needed, from boogie boards and snorkeling equipment to towels and blankets. There was even a very cool domino table! I think our very favorite part of the house is the HUGE balcony that wraps around the 2nd floor. We spent most of our time outside talking, laughing, eating, etc. The hammocks were heaven :)
Anyway, young or old, adventurous or not, I recommend this house to everyone. It really is a little paradise!
